The sympathetic nervous system activates the sweat glands through the chemical messenger acetylcholine. A procedure called iontophoresis has been used for more than 50 years to treat excessive sweating on the hands or feet, and more recently, in the underarm. Researchers reported in the American Heart Association's November 2002 issue of "Circulation" that people who don't usually drink coffee responded to coffee intake whether caffeinated or decaffeinated with an increase in blood pressure from SNS activation.
